      GENERAL SUMMARY:

      Responsible for and is proficient in all functions of the Patient Access Department, including: pre-admitting, admitting, receptionist duties and scheduling of patients for hospital and clinic procedures and appointments. Must be able to perform all job duties and responsibilities in all facility areas that the Patient Access Department covers. Asks senior staff for guidance on more complex and unique situations.

      PRINCIPAL JOB FUNCTIONS:

      • Commits to the mission, vision, beliefs and consistently demonstrates our core values.
      • Performs service excellence must-haves to achieve an excellent patient/customer experience.
      • Uses quality improvement processes, programs or outcome to help improve department operations.
      • Performs services related to Patient Access Department including receptionist, switchboard, scheduling admits, check in check out of patients. Asks senior staff for assistance on more unique issues.
      • Performs opening and closing tasks of admissions area.
      • Performs pre-admission, admission and dismissal functions for all hospital and clinic areas including – Acute, Emergency, Surgery, Outpatient, Cardiac Rehab, Physical Therapy, and Physician’s Clinic. Asks senior staff for assistance on more unique and/or complex issues
      • Registers and checks in patients as they arrive for services. Obtains, scans and enters the demographic information, insurance coverage and all required forms into the computer system correctly:
      • Keeps all admissions, forms and computer information up to date.
      • Completes and distributes census report.
      • Directs patients and visitors and gives them appropriate information.
      • Prepares and provides patients with an estimate, if one is warranted, for their expected services. Collects and/or counsels on expected payment due.
      • Participates in meetings, committees and lean projects as assigned.
      • Maintains professional growth and development through seminars, workshops, and professional affiliations to keep abreast of latest trends in field of expertise.
      • Performs other related projects and duties as assigned.

      E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E:

      High School Diploma or equivalent required. Minimum of two (2) years of office experience preferred. Prior hospital experience desired.
